The Dangers of Engine Idling

When your car is idling, it’s running the engine while the vehicle is stationary. This may seem harmless, but in reality, idling for extended periods of time can lead to various issues that can speed up the deterioration of your vehicle. One of the main dangers of engine idling is the excessive wear on the engine components, such as the pistons, cylinders, and spark plugs. The engine is designed to operate efficiently while the vehicle is in motion, so when it’s idling, the components can wear down faster due to the lack of proper lubrication and cooling.

In addition to engine wear, excessive idling can also lead to increased fuel consumption, as the engine continues to burn fuel while not moving. This not only wastes fuel and increases your carbon footprint but also puts unnecessary strain on your wallet. Moreover, idling can result in a build-up of carbon deposits in the engine, which can lead to decreased fuel efficiency and performance over time.

Effects on the Environment

Apart from the negative impact on your vehicle, excessive engine idling also contributes to air pollution and environmental degradation. When a car is left idling, it releases harmful emissions such as carbon monoxide, nitrogen oxides, and volatile organic compounds into the atmosphere. These pollutants not only harm the environment but also pose health risks to humans, especially those with respiratory conditions.

According to studies, an hour of idling can produce as much pollution as driving 25 miles. Imagine the cumulative effect of idling for days, weeks, or even years. By reducing unnecessary engine idling, you can play a part in minimizing air pollution and protecting the environment for future generations.

How to Minimize Engine Idling

Now that we understand the negative effects of engine idling, it’s essential to take steps to minimize idling time whenever possible. Here are some practical tips to help you reduce unnecessary engine idling and preserve your vehicle’s longevity:

1. Turn Off the Engine

Whenever you anticipate being stationary for more than a minute, such as waiting at a railroad crossing or dropping someone off, consider turning off the engine. Restarting the engine uses less fuel than idling for extended periods.

2. Use Remote Start

If you live in a cold climate and use remote start to warm up your car in the winter, set a timer to avoid excessive idling. Most modern vehicles warm up quickly, so there’s no need to let the engine run for extended periods.

3. Plan Your Routes

Try to plan your driving routes to minimize sitting in traffic or waiting for long periods. Avoid congested areas during peak hours to reduce the temptation to idle unnecessarily.

4. Maintain Your Vehicle

Regular maintenance is crucial to keep your vehicle running efficiently. Ensure that your engine is in good condition, with proper lubrication and cooling systems, to reduce the wear and tear associated with idling.

Frequently Asked Questions

1. How long can my car idle before it causes damage?

Extended idling for more than 10 minutes can contribute to engine wear and reduced fuel efficiency. It’s best to turn off the engine if you anticipate being stationary for an extended period.

2. Does idling save fuel compared to restarting the engine?

Contrary to popular belief, restarting the engine uses less fuel than idling for more than a minute. It’s more fuel-efficient to turn off the engine and restart when needed.

3. Can engine idling affect the battery life?

Excessive idling can put a strain on the battery, especially if the alternator is not charging the battery enough while idling. Over time, this can lead to premature battery failure.

4. Are there any laws or regulations regarding engine idling?

Some states and municipalities have idling laws to reduce emissions and protect air quality. Check local regulations to ensure compliance with idling restrictions.
